It's very hard to see in the photo, but I did run each petal through a texturz plate (it didn't come out as deep as Audreys) I also ran the vanilla square through the big shot, sponged the edges of the leaves and used the flower petal to stamp over the leaves. Added some ribbon, hardware, made my vanilla button using three layers and added crystal effects to it. The whole panel is popped up.
